About the Item
Hand painted oyster plate (pale blue and pink) by Joseph Schachtel, Sophienau. Octagonal six well, exquisitely hand-painted plates. Elevate your dining table or walls with these unique, small pieces art!
Marked with the Schachtel Eagle over J.S. and numbered 1775. JS used this marker between the years 1887-1919 (Germany). Shallow 2cm chip to underside rim of one plate.
